What Is Contract Law?
Contract law governs the creation, execution, and enforcement of contractual agreements between parties. It ensures that contracts, both written and verbal, are legally binding and that all parties fulfill their obligations. Contract law helps protect the interests of all parties involved in a contract, providing legal remedies if one party fails to meet their contractual duties. Contract law is essential in many areas, including business transactions, employment agreements, sales, real estate deals, and service contracts, ensuring that agreements are fair, clear, and enforceable.
What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Contracts Lawyer?
You might need a contracts lawyer in several situations:
- You are starting a business and need to draft partnership agreements
- You need to negotiate employment contracts
- You want to create or review a lease
- You need to draft a sales agreement for goods and services
- You are in a dispute with a vendor over the terms of a contract

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Contracts Lawyer?
If you don’t hire a contract lawyer, you may face several risks:
- You might draft or sign an agreement with unclear terms or unfavorable conditions, leading to misunderstandings or disputes
- You could miss critical legal requirements, making the contract unenforceable
- If someone breaches the contract, you might struggle to enforce your rights or secure compensation
Contract lawyers are good at anticipating problems you might not have thought of, and resolving contract disputes without legal assistance can be challenging and time-consuming. Hiring a contracts lawyer ensures that your agreements are legally sound, protects your interests, and helps avoid costly legal issues.
What Questions Should I Ask When Trying To Find a Contracts Lawyer in Bay Shore?
These questions can help you decide if you feel comfortable and confident that a lawyer has the qualifications, experience, and ability to manage your case well. Many lawyers offer free consultations that allow you to understand your options and get specific legal advice before hiring them. The top questions to ask include:
- Have you drafted contracts like the one I need?
- What are the potential outcomes of my case?
- What is the timeline for my case?
- Are there alternative dispute resolutions available, like mediation or arbitration?
- What is your billing and fee structure?
- How long have you practiced in New York?
- What is your approach to negotiations and settlements?
- What will my involvement be during the process?
